Gaetz made fun of the physical appearance of women who are against the overturn of the abortion law.

Gaetz referred to pro-choice women at rallies as "disgusting" and "odious" while speaking to college students.

Gaetz said that ugly women shouldn't be worried about abortion access.

He wanted to know why the women with the least chance of getting pregnant are the ones most concerned about having abortions.

Gaetz said that pro-choice women wouldn't want to have a baby if they looked like a thumb.

The congressman derided women who are "5-foot-2 and 350 pounds" and marched in protests against the Supreme Court's decision to overturn the case that legalized abortion.

"They need to get up and march for an hour a day, swing those arms, and maybe mix in a salad," Gaetz said.

The speech was derided by a feminist media outlet.

The Justice Department is looking into whether Gaetz violated federal sex trafficking laws with a 17-year-old girl in 2019.

In May, Gaetz asked how many of the women who were protesting against abortion were over-educated and under-loved.
